    I'm seeing this happen a bunch in list building on the forums. You can run your link team in combat group one with all your other guys. Leave maybe the Yaogat or Sogarat in combat group 2. What this does is give your link team 10 orders to use instead of only 5. This makes them more effective. 

     

    The Daturazi are impetuous. This means at the beginning of your turn, you have to use their impetuous order on them, they get no benefits of cover and they have to move directly towards the closest enemy model. If they are in a link team, you ignore the impetuous orders and all of the effects. They can then use cover normally and don't have to move to the closest enemy.

  5. The reason I have them in group 2 is because I was going to fire team (link team, whatever the term). 

    In that case, you want them in the group with the most orders. Then you can use all 10 orders on that fireteam if you choose to. It makes them much more effective.

  7. The army builder is buggy so it isn't you, does it to me all the time. I'd make a full combat group of 10 models. This way you can rambo your tag around and kill everything without running out of orders too fast. As models die, you can use your command tokens to move models from group 2 to group 1 to keep your order count high.

  8. One of the big sayings in Infinity is "it's not your list, it's you". It's a really accurate statement. All the factions are very well balanced. Even between sectorials and vanilla, you'll find things are pretty even. So just like the others are saying, find the models you like and go from there.

  10. Nomads are a great starter army. They have a little bit of everything. Pan Oceania is another good starter army. They both come in the Operation Ice Storm starter box. It comes with dice, rules, starter missions, models for both factions.
